Biography
Floyd Patterson's talent and ambition took the boxing world by storm. He appeared out of nowhere to claim the New York Golden Gloves title in both 1951 and 1952. After his second victory, the unstoppable rookie was off to chase an Olympic medal. Seventeen-year-old Patterson made international headlines when he took the middleweight gold medal in Helsinki, Finland, at the 1952 Olympics.
